Job Description
- Establish, implement, and continuously enhance the SOC operating model, ensuring scalable, resilient, and effective 24/7 security monitoring and incident response capabilities.
- Lead and oversee all SOC functions, including security monitoring, alert triage, threat detection, incident response, digital forensics, and recovery activities.
- Define and implement SOC strategy, roadmap, and maturity improvement plans aligned with the Bank’s overall IT security strategy.
- Manage and optimize security technologies, including SIEM, EDR/XDR, WAF, SOAR, and threat intelligence platforms, ensuring integration, automation, and full visibility across the Bank’s environment.
- Establish and continuously improve detection use cases, correlation rules, and playbooks to enhance detection accuracy and reduce false positives.
- Lead proactive threat hunting and adversary detection activities using threat intelligence and advanced analytics.
- Oversee end-to-end incident response management, ensuring timely detection, containment, eradication, recovery, and post-incident review with proper documentation.
- Integrate and operationalize threat intelligence, ensuring relevance to the Bank’s risk profile and emerging cyber threats.
- Ensure comprehensive logging, monitoring, and visibility across infrastructure, applications, and digital banking platforms.
- Conduct root cause analysis and ensure implementation of corrective and preventive actions to strengthen the Bank’s security posture.
- Ensure SOC readiness for major cyber incidents and crisis situations, including leading cyber drills, simulations, and incident response exercises.
- Collaborate with Infrastructure Security and Application Security and Identity Management, to ensure timely remediation of incidents and alignment of controls.
- Ensure compliance with regulatory directives, internal policies, and standards such as ISO 27001, NIST, and PCI DSS, including requirements from the National Bank of Ethiopia.
- Define and monitor SOC KPIs and performance metrics, including detection time, response time, incident trends, and operational efficiency.
- Prepare and present regular reports on threat landscape, SOC performance, incidents, and risks to the management
Job Requirements
First Degree in Computer Science/Information Technology/Computer Engineering/MIS/or related fields with 9 years of relevant experience of which 3 years in supervisory level.
